Around Mount Vernon ...

The largest community within a 50 mile [80 km] radius is Arlington. It is located about 10 miles [16 km] to the north of Mount Vernon. Arlington has a population of 208,000 people.<1>.

The next largest community is Alexandria. It lies just northeast of Mount Vernon and has a population of 159,000 people.

Fairfax County ...

Mount Vernon is located in Fairfax County<4>.

The following counties adjoin and form the boundaries of Fairfax County: Charles (MD), Montgomery (MD), Prince George's (MD), Arlington, Falls Church City, Loudoun & Prince William.
